1.2 What is a cookie?
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device (computer, tablet, smartphone) by websites you visit. They are often used to make websites work or to make them more efficient, as well as to provide information to the website operator. Cookies can be used for various purposes, e.g. to store your login details, remember your preferences or analyse your use of the website.

4.1 Legal basis for the use of cookies (GDPR)
The legal basis for the processing of personal data by cookies depends on the type of cookie:
- Essential cookies: The legal basis is our legitimate interest pursuant to Art. 6 para. 1 lit. f GDPR, as these cookies are essential for the operation of our website and enable you to use our services.
- Functional, analysis and performance, advertising and marketing cookies: For these cookies, we obtain your consent in accordance with Art. 6 para. 1 lit. a GDPR. Your consent is obtained via our cookie consent banner and can be revoked at any time.
